The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ited

The Charity manages investments, both property and financial, in order to preserve the capital and generate income. The income is applied to make grants to individuals and organisations who apply for assistance with personal and community projects in the Cambridgeshire area.

How much income did The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ited report in 2024?

The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ited reported total income of £122k and reported expenditure of £76k for the financial year ending 2024,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

When was The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ited registered as a charity?

The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 10 November 2009 as charity number 1132630. It has been registered for 17 years.

Who runs The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ited?

The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ited is governed by a board of 5 trustees. The chair of trustees is JOHN FRANCIS FINN.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ited operate?

The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ited operates in Cambridgeshire, as recorded in its Charity Commission filing.

Is The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ited a registered charity?

Yes — The Fisher Parkinson Trust Limited is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1132630.
